War Department.

The oval containing the bust, the scrolls or labels and numerals are placed on a back ground of parallel vertical lines above and below, horizontal on the sides. In the upper corners "U." on the left, "S." on the right. A curved solid label bordered by a cord, cuts off the upper corners and is inscribed on the left "War" on right "Dept." in the usual capitals. The lines of the sides are arranged to show the stripes of the flag. A shield on each side above the scrolls or beneath the labels.

Plate impression 19½ by 25 mm., in color, on white paper, perforated 12.

The shades of these stamps vary somewhat in intensity, some being much lighter and some darker than ordinary.

Navy Department.

The ovals containing the busts, the labels or scrolls and large numerals are placed on a ground of vertical parallel lines. A large, six-pointed star in each upper corner, and a smaller one on each side. A cable runs round the sides and top. The words "Navy" on the left and "Dept." on the right in the usual capitals across the upper corners and a losenge with "U." on the left and "S." on the right shaded in the lower corners and placed diagonally above the scrolls or below the labels.
